-#pragma db object
-struct object
-{
- object () {}
- object (unsigned int id): id_ (id) {}
-
- #pragma db id
- unsigned int id_;
-
- // Integer types.
- //
- #pragma db type ("BIT")
- unsigned char bit_;
-
- #pragma db type ("TINYINT")
- unsigned char utint_;
-
- #pragma db type ("TINYINT")
- unsigned char stint_;
-
- #pragma db type ("SMALLINT")
- unsigned short usint_;
-
- #pragma db type ("SMALLINT")
- short ssint_;
-
- #pragma db type ("INT")
- unsigned int uint_;
-
- #pragma db type ("INTEGER")
- int sint_;
-
- #pragma db type ("BIGINT")
- unsigned long long ubint_;
-
- #pragma db type ("BIGINT")
- long long sbint_;
-
- // Floating/fixed point types.
- //
- #pragma db type ("SMALLMONEY")
- float fsm_;
-
- #pragma db type ("SMALLMONEY")
- double dsm_;
-
- #pragma db type ("SMALLMONEY")
- int ism_;
-
- #pragma db type ("MONEY")
- double dm1_;
-
- #pragma db type ("MONEY")
- double dm2_;
-
- #pragma db type ("MONEY")
- long long im_;
-
- #pragma db type ("REAL")
- float f4_;
-
- #pragma db type ("FLOAT")
- double f8_;
-
- // Strings.
- //
- #pragma db type ("CHAR(20)")
- std::string schar_;
-
- #pragma db type ("VARCHAR(128)")
- std::string svchar_;
-
- #pragma db type ("CHAR(1025)")
- std::string lchar_;
-
- #pragma db type ("CHARACTER VARYING(8000)")
- std::string lvchar_;
-
- #pragma db type ("VARCHAR(max)")
- std::string mvchar_;
-
- #pragma db type ("TEXT")
- std::string text_;
-
- // National strings.
- //
- #pragma db type ("NCHAR(20)")
- std::wstring snchar_;
-
- #pragma db type ("NVARCHAR(128)")
- std::wstring snvchar_;
-
- #pragma db type ("NCHAR(513)")
- std::wstring lnchar_;
-
- #pragma db type ("NATIONAL CHARACTER VARYING(4000)")
- std::wstring lnvchar_;
-
- #pragma db type ("NVARCHAR(max)")
- std::wstring mnvchar_;
-
- #pragma db type ("NTEXT")
- std::wstring ntext_;
-
- // Binary.
- //
- #pragma db type ("BINARY(9)")
- unsigned char sbin_[9];
-
- #pragma db type ("VARBINARY(256)")
- std::vector<char> svbin_;
-
- #pragma db type ("BINARY(1025)")
- char lbin_[1025];
-
- #pragma db type ("BINARY VARYING(8000)")
- std::vector<char> lvbin_;
-
- #pragma db type ("VARBINARY(max)")
- std::vector<unsigned char> mvbin_;
-
- #pragma db type ("IMAGE")
- std::vector<char> image_;
-
- // Date-time. SQL Server 2005 (9.0) only has DATETIME and SMALLDATETIME.
- //
-#if !defined(MSSQL_SERVER_VERSION) || MSSQL_SERVER_VERSION >= 1000
- #pragma db type ("DATE")
- date_time date_;
-
- #pragma db type ("TIME")
- date_time time7_;
-
- #pragma db type ("TIME(4)")
- date_time time4_;
-#endif
-
- #pragma db type ("SMALLDATETIME")
- date_time sdt_;
-
- #pragma db type ("DATETIME")
- date_time dt_;
-
-#if !defined(MSSQL_SERVER_VERSION) || MSSQL_SERVER_VERSION >= 1000
- #pragma db type ("DATETIME2")
- date_time dt2_;
-
- #pragma db type ("DATETIMEOFFSET")
- date_time dto7_;
-
- #pragma db type ("DATETIMEOFFSET(0)")
- date_time dto0_;
-#endif
-
- // Other types.
- //
-#if defined(_WIN32) || defined(HOST_WIN32)
- //#pragma db type ("UNIQUEIDENTIFIER")
- GUID guid_;
-#endif
-
- #pragma db type ("UNIQUEIDENTIFIER")
- char uuid_[16];
